Transaction f31aadcf01b50485708f7c10d7303f0abf9059df12220771ce923537f0a03b48
1 Input
2 Outputs
- f31aadcf01b50485708f7c10d7303f0abf9059df12220771ce923537f0a03b48:0
- f31aadcf01b50485708f7c10d7303f0abf9059df12220771ce923537f0a03b48:1
value 22245660
address 39R5KmhNfviFs9WJYU4B2zUH7aYt81ddUX
value 3182093035
address 15pMKaCPkKsdfYc4rRPmXXAiHrHsTfEP4Z